How Roof Covering Air Flow Functions
Reliable roofing system ventilation relies upon the natural movement of air to create an equilibrium in between consumption and exhaust. When you set up vents, you're basically allowing fresh air to enter your attic room while allowing hot, stagnant air to run away. This process assists regulate temperature and moisture levels, preventing issues like mold and mildew growth and roofing damage.
Consumption vents, typically discovered at the eaves, attract great air from outdoors. At the same time, exhaust vents, located near the ridge of the roof covering, let hot air surge and leave. The distinction in temperature level produces a natural air movement, known as the pile result. As warm air rises, it produces a vacuum cleaner that draws in cooler air from the lower vents.
To optimize this system, you need to ensure that the consumption and exhaust vents are appropriately sized and positioned. If the intake is limited, you won't accomplish the desired air flow.
Similarly, inadequate exhaust can trap warmth and wetness, resulting in possible damages.
Key Installation Considerations
When setting up roofing system ventilation, numerous essential factors to consider can make or break your system's effectiveness. First, you require to assess your roof covering's style. The pitch, shape, and products all influence air movement and air flow option. Make sure to select vents that fit your roofing kind and local environment problems.

Location intake vents short on the roofing system and exhaust vents near the height to motivate an all-natural circulation of air. This arrangement aids prevent moisture build-up and advertises power performance.
Do not ignore insulation. Appropriate insulation in your attic room stops warm from escaping and maintains your home comfy. Guarantee that insulation doesn't obstruct your vents, as this can hinder air movement.
Lastly, think about maintenance. Choose air flow systems that are simple to access for cleansing and assessment. Regular upkeep ensures your system remains to work efficiently in time.
